@SthrnMixer after cleaning up the Ironwood, and checking the ash levels, they appeared to be slightly higher than the Traeger pellets. Not much but noticeable.
Still seems like a win/win for me with the Lumberjack pellets.
- Much better smoke flavor
- Much hotter burning, i.e. more efficient.
- Slightly more ash.
